    NJ Assemblyman Challenges Governor's Justification for Taxpayer-Funded Helicopter Trip

    Assemblyman Alex Sauickie questions Governor Sherrill's helicopter trip to Annapolis, calling for transparency. This scrutiny may lead to stricter policies governing state-funded travel and increased accountability for use of government resources in executive travel decisions.

    Texas Governor Initiates Financial Reviews of School Districts for Transparency

    Governor Greg Abbott has ordered financial reviews of independent school districts in Texas to ensure the effective use of the $104.9 billion allocated for K-12 education. The findings, due by December 31, 2026, may lead to legislative changes addressing funding and procurement practices.

    Chicago Officials Sentenced for Over $1 Million Procurement Fraud

    Federal authorities have sentenced three individuals for defrauding Chicago Public Schools. This case highlights the essential need for robust oversight in education procurement to safeguard public funds and ensure accountability.

    Oklahoma Education Reforms Aim for Funding Equity and Increased Instructional Days

    Governor Kevin Stitt, via Secretary Dan Hamlin, proposes major reforms to Oklahoma’s school financing. The reforms are set to address funding disparities and ensure compliance with instructional day requirements, influencing vendors and contractors relying on education budgets.

    Idanre-Owena Road Project Faces Scrutiny Amidst Lack of Progress

    A petition has been filed with the EFCC regarding the stalled Idanre-Owena road rehabilitation project in Ondo State, raising concerns over fund utilization. The Federal Ministry of Works is urged to investigate the lack of contractor mobilization despite the project being included in federal budgets.

    Washington State AG Leads Coalition Urging Transparency in ICE Detention Policies

    Washington State AG Nick Brown, supported by 22 AGs, is advocating for the reversal of ICE's policy that limits transparency regarding detainee deaths post-release. This move could significantly impact procurement strategies for contracts involving private detention facilities, heightening the accountability expectations and compliance standards for contractors.

    Kenya's EACC Arrests Security Firm Director Over Sh5.4M Procurement Fraud

    The Ethics and Anti-Corruption Commission arrested Gilbert Momanyi Maturwe, director of Gimo Security, for alleged procurement fraud concerning a security services contract worth **Sh5.4 million** involving Keroka Technical Training Institute. This case highlights the significant need for scrutiny and compliance in public procurement processes.

    Bengaluru Authority Suspends Engineer Amid Infrastructure Quality Concerns

    The suspension of Assistant Engineer Pujarappa by the Greater Bengaluru Authority underscores the government's commitment to quality in public works. This action points to intensified oversight and potential repercussions for contractors that fail to meet standards, signaling a significant shift towards accountability in municipal projects.

    Oklahoma Enacts OSSAA Transparency Bill to Enhance Accountability

    Oklahoma's new law mandates public hearings for OSSAA eligibility cases, impacting procurement practices. With the elimination of automatic ineligibility for transferring students, contractors may need to revise compliance strategies and adapt contracts. This move indicates a broader shift towards transparency in state educational governance.
